ICPC  seeks public support on fight against corruption

The ‎Independent corrupt practices and other related offences commission(ICPC) has charged other federal agencies not to leave the fight against corruption with it and the economic and financial commission (EFCC)

Rather,the commission said they should join them in the anti-graft fight so as to rip Nigeria of corrupt element,thereby baling the county out of its social-economic challenges

The ICPC commissioner in charge of OYO and OGUN Mr.Stephen Pimor, have the charge while speaking at the lunch of anti-corruption postage stamps at the Ibadan area office of the Nigerian postal service (NIPOST) on Monday

Pimor who was represented by the Principal superintendent officer of ICPC‎ Mr.Ayo Opara said corruption was not  limited to embezzlement of public funds alone but that it could also be attitudinal

 

“There’s general mistake that most of us in Nigeria make.Most people think that corruption is all about embezzlement of public funds. But the fact is corruption is all-encompassing  and attitudinal.

 

“For instance, a civil servants who always comes late to work is corrupt. A civil servants who come to work early but refuse carryout is official duties as expected or is found to negligence and lackadaisical is nothing but corrupt “he said

 

Pimor advice Nigerians and corporate bodies to take the war against corruption been championed by the present administration seriously and give all the necessary support to Government to ensure success

He commended NIPOSTor teaming up with ICPC to‎ stamp out corruption through the laughing of the anti -corruption postage stamps, calling on other corporate organizations to emulate NIPOST

 
In his welcome address,the  area postal manager NIPOST Oyo territory ,Mr.Babatude Ajayi said corruption had been come so endemic in Nigeria that the fight against it should no longer be left in hands of anti-corruption agencies such as ICPC,EFCC and others

 

 

Ajayi said NiPOST decided to key into government policy directions by issuing a set of four postage stamps as part of its contribution towards sentzing Nigerians on the menace of corruption

 

 

He described the lunch of the postage stamps ‎as timely, saying “the fight against in our history as nation has never been this fierce and productive

 

According to him,NIPOST decided to use postage stamps ‎as a tool of disseminating vital information about anti-corruption as it would serve as veritable instruments of taken the fight to the remotes part of the country where no Internet connectivity exist
